錯誤描述:Qt在linux系統編譯時,遇到一個錯誤大致如下形式
1 在 xxxxx函數中 2 3 對‘vtable for xxxxx未定義的引用
網上找了很多,各種情況都有,大多數是虛函數未實現導致的,
但也有可能是Qt中的信號與槽機制導致的。
如果你的代碼里面有涉及到自定義信號與槽,一定要確保pro文件中已經包含了對應的頭文件
即在pro中增加:
1 HEADERS += xxxxx.h
qmake
make即可
錯誤描述:Qt在linux系統編譯時,遇到一個錯誤大致如下形式
1 在 xxxxx函數中 2 3 對‘vtable for xxxxx未定義的引用
網上找了很多,各種情況都有,大多數是虛函數未實現導致的,
但也有可能是Qt中的信號與槽機制導致的。
如果你的代碼里面有涉及到自定義信號與槽,一定要確保pro文件中已經包含了對應的頭文件
即在pro中增加:
1 HEADERS += xxxxx.h
qmake
make即可
本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。